Our school is one that has been on an exciting journey of development. Formed from previous separate infant and junior schools in 2021, our newly formed primary school serves the community of New Town and beyond, and is committed to be inclusive of all.

Many of our classrooms are newly refurbished and are lovely places to teach and learn. With capacity for 680 children, including our own nursery, we are one of the largest primary settings in the area, and provide a true team ethos in which to grow professionally.

However, we still have much to do and believe that, by working in partnership to achieve a common purpose, we can continue to provide a school that is at the cutting edge of educational practice. We are graded 'Good' by Ofsted (2023) and are an Inclusion Quality Mark Centre of Excellence. In the last available value added benchmarks we were one of the highest rated schools in the locality.
